"Once cultivated by Persian kings and believed to have healing powers, saffron is now fuelling the growth of a small German business that imports tons of the spice from Iran to make fine food products for sale in Europe and the Gulf. "We try to capture the soul of saffron and the magic it contains," says Michael Sabet, an Iranian-German business executive who quit his banking job six years ago to found Miasa GmbH, which is now doubling its revenues every year. Sabet is one of many German business leaders who see great business opportunities opening up in Iran after the end of sanctions related to its nuclear weapons programme." (Reuters, "Iranian saffron fuels growth of German food business," 9/30/2016). (http://www.reuters.com/article/germany-iran-saffron-idUSL2N1C51AX)
